This document provides design calculations for the foundation of an autotransformer for a 132kV transmission line project in Bangladesh. Specifically, it details calculations for the Joydevpur-Kabirpur-Tangail transmission line being constructed by the Power Grid Company of Bangladesh. The document was designed by Md. Giasuddin on November 19, 2005 and is part of the submission for Section 12 of the project, which covers building and civil engineering works.

Design of Transformer Foundation ; Joydevpur 132/33kV Sub-station

1. GENERAL
1.1 Considerations :

a) Raft foundation is considered for a 132kV Transformer.


 b) The bottom of the r aft is at a depth of 1.0m from existing ground surface.
2
c) Soil bearing capacity is considered 90.04 kN/m minimum value from BH-4, BH-5 & BH-7.
d) The Top of bund wall is 200mm above the finished switchyard surface level.

1.2 Soil Data:

Allowable bearing capacity of soil is considered : 90.04 kN/sqm


Unit weight of soil : 17.94 kN/cum.
Frustum angle : 15.00 Deg.
Water Table from EGL : 2.50 m
1.3 Material Properties :
Concrete………………...…fc'= 20 N/mm2
Reinforcing Steel…………..f y = 415 N/mm2
Concrete Clear Cover……….= 60 mm
Unit Weight of Concrete…….= 24.0 kN/cum.
2. DESIGN DATA AND FOUNDATION GEOMETRY :
( Reference Dwg no. 56.20.3-03-3537)
Transformer's Length = 6.80 m
Transformer's Width = 5.10 m
Height of Transformer = 5.00 m
Total Weight of Tx. ( with Oil ) = 72,000 Kg
Weight of Oil = 19,000 Kg
Density of Oil = 840 Kg/cum.
Total volume of oil = 22.62 Cum
Pit volume reqd. below the stone ( 125% of oil vol. ) = 28.27 Cum
Inside length of pit considered = 7.80 m
Inside width of pit considered = 5.80 m
Surface area of the pit = 41.47 sqm.
Width of Tx. Supporting Pedestal = 2.68 m
Length of Tx. Supporting Pedestal = 3.89 m
Area of Tx. Supporting Pedestal = 10.4 sqm.
 Net surface area of the pit = 31.0 sqm.
Average Depth required = 0.9 m
Provided depth below Grating = 0.90 m
Thickness of grating = 0.05 m
Thickness of gravel layer on top of grating = 0.225 m
Free height above gravel top = 0.05 m
Max. height of pit wall above base slab = 1.225 m

3. LOAD CALCULATION

Transformer Length, L = 6.80 m


Transformer Width, B = 5.10 m
Transformer Height above top of Pedestal, H = 5.00 m
Total weight of Transformer ( with oil ) = 720.00 kN

3.1 Wind load calculation - as per BNBC

Maximum wind velocity , Vb = 160.0 km/hr ( Specified in the Contract specification)


Height of top of transformer from FSYL = 5.20 m
q z = c cc I c z v 2 b ( Ref. Bangladesh National Building Code 1993, Chapter 
2;Page 6-33)
For exposure B , Cz at Top = 0.85
For exposure B , Cz at Bottom = 0.801
Velocity to Pressure conversion coefficient, Cc = 4.72E-05
Structure Importance Factor CI = 1.25
q z = 1.284 kN/m2 ; at Top
= 1.210 kN/m2 ; at Bottom
( Ref. Bangladesh National Building Code 1993, Chapter 
Design Wind Pressure, pz = c Gc pq z
2;Page 6-34)
L/B = 1.33
H/B = 0.98
- ,  p .
Gust Co-efficient, CG = 1 .30
Design Wind Pressure, p z = 1.335 kN/m2 ; at Top
= 1.258 kN/m2 ; at Bottom
Average Pressure , Pz = 1.29671 kN/m2
∴ Force results from Wind = 1.297*6.8*5.1 = 44.97 kN

3.2 Seismic load calculation - as per BNBC

 ZICW 
( Ref. Bangladesh National Building Code 1993, Chapter 
Design Base Shear is given by : V  =

 R 2;Page 6-53)
Where, Z = Seismic Zone Co-efficient = 0.15 ( for Zone 2 )
I = Structure Importance Factor = 1.25 ( with essential Facilities )
R = Response Modification Coefficient = 6 ( For RCC wall System )
1.25S
C = Numerical coefficien t system is given by : C  = 2
3

S = Site coefficient for soil characteristics = 1.5
3
T = Fundamental period of vibration is given by : T = Ct ( hn ) 4

Ct = 0.049 ( For all type of non braced RCC structure )


hn = 5.00 m
T = 0.164 Sec
C = 6.262
W = Total Seismic dead load =Transformer Weight = 720.00 kN
Design base shear V = 140.90 kN

4.2 Check for Settlement :
Settlement of a Soil layer is given by :
cc p0 + Δp
S = H  log10
1 + e0 p0
Where, Cc = Compression Index = 0.258 From soil test report of BH-4.
e0 = Initial Void ratio = 0.989 From soil test report of BH-4.
H = Thickness of the Soil Layer = 5.00 m From soil test report of BH-4.
 p0 = The original Soil Pressure at the mid point of the
layer = γ∗H/2 = 45.00 kN/m2
Δ p = Change In Pressure = qmax - γDf  = 25.60 kN/m2
S = 0.1269 ft. = 1.524 inch.
Which is less than 2.0" , so OK.

6. DESIGN OF GRATINGS

Layout of Gratings :

Steel of Fy 275.0 Mpa shall be used for gratings.


Main bar : 50X6 Flat
Spacing of main bar : 30 mm c/c
Secondary bar dia. = 12 mm

Spacing of secondary bar : 100 mm c/c


Thickness of gravel paving = 225 mm
Unit weight of gravel = 16.00 kN/cum
Max span of main bar = 1.698 m

6.1 Design of main bar :


Self weight of grating : 0.56 kN/sqm
Self weight of gravel : 3.60 kN/sqm
Assumed live load : 2.00 kN/sqm
Total load per unit area = 6.16 kN/sqm
Uniform Distributed Load per main bar = 0.185 kN/m
Check for bending stress :
2
Max bending moment = 0.185*1.698 /8 = 0.067kN.m
2
Zxx of main bar = 6*50 /6 = 2500 mm3
Max bending stress = 0.067*10^6/2500 = 26.64 Mpa
Allowable bending stress = 0.6*Fy = 0.6*275 = 165.00 Mpa ; So OK.
Check for shear stress :
Max shear force = 0.157 kN
Max shear stress = 0.52 Mpa
Allowable Shear stress = 0.346*Fy = 0.346*275 = 95.15 Mpa ; So OK.
Check for max deflection :

Ixx of main bar = 6*50^3/12 = 62500 mm4


Modulus of elasticity of steel = 200000 Mpa
4
= = .
Allowable Maximum deflection = l/325 = 5.22 mm ; So OK.
